Abstract

This article is about the effect of forest fires in Kalimantan on increasing air pollution for surrounding countries. The problem of forest fires has become a national issue that is of serious concern to the government. This incident occurs repeatedly every year, especially on the island of Kalimantan. Indonesia has very extensive and dense tropical forests, especially in the Papua and Kalimantan regions. These forests contribute significantly to oxygen production and carbon dioxide storage, which are important factors in maintaining global climate balance. Some people in Indonesia depend directly or indirectly on forests to earn a living and meet their daily needs. Air pollution due to forest fires in Indonesia does not only impact local areas, but can also spread to neighboring countries such as Malaysia, Singapore and Brunei. This can worsen the air quality and health of the citizens of these countries.
